Increment case of Customs sepoys lingering on

LAHORE: AGPR Punjab Division has objected pre-mature increments of sepoys of the Pakistan Customs Lahore, an official circular stated.

The circular said that the service books of all the sepoys have been submitted to the AGPR for the release of maturing increments but the AGPR has objected that Customs sepoys are required to submit option form along with pay slip and Computerised National Identity Card number to get the amount of their maturing increment.

The circular has urged the Customs Appraisement and Preventive Lahore sepoys which are over 700 to get form and deposit it with AGPR to have their cases processed at the earliest.

The maturing increment case of the Customs sepoys has been lingered on for the last one year and the number of employees have been failed to attain their maturing increments, while the customs sepoys in other parts of the country have been given their maturing increments, officials said.

They said that govt was using delaying tactics to further delay their maturing increments, adding that another six months’ time will be required to them to release the maturing increments.

They urged the authorities concerned to take notice of the matter.
